FRESH FRIDAYS: A Global Fusion of Taste & Sound
OPENING NIGHT – Friday Aug 3d, 2012
The “Midsummer Soiree” - A Global Tapas and Community “Mocktail” Party, featuring Live Jazz, Delicious Food & Exotic “Mocktails” by local guest mixologists and chefs, is happening from 6 to 8PM, at First Parish Church, 10 Parish St., Dorchester 02122.
The Dorchester Community Food Co-op and Sustainability Guild International are presenting an exciting series of Friday night events August through September. There will be live entertainment & savory food and beverages, and activities for children. Join in a celebration of the essence of Dorchester through diverse voices, talents and flavors!

Dorchester Garden Council meets 1st Tuesdays - "Dot Grows!"
Garden plots in Dorchester community gardens are starting to grow!
The Dorchester Garden Council helps community gardeners prepare for a busy season. The Council, called "Dot Grows!" meets at Codman Square Health Center in Conference Room B, located on the lower level, from 6 to 7:30 PM. The agenda includes discussion of upcoming workshops and meets every 1st Tuesday - contact Grantley for details.

Dorchester garden plots available!
A new and improved Nightingale Community Garden is now under construction, with all new watering system, clean garden soil, accessible raised beds and pathways coming online in June. Head on over to Park Street (near Washington Street) to check it out! Interested in signing up for a plot? There are application forms available right at the garden - fill one out and drop it in the garden's mailbox. Read this Dorchester Reporter article for particulars.
